Bio
Honors
• American Athletic Conference honorable mention all-conference (2019)
• Tiger 3.0 Club for 2019 spring semester
• 2016-17 American Athletic Conference All-Academic Team
• 2016 Glenn Jones Defensive Scout Team Player of the Year
2020 (Redshirt Senior)
• Member of the 8-3 Tigers who won the 2020 Montgomery Bowl
• Appeared in all 11 games on the season, earning 10 starts
• Totaled 30 tackles, 21 solo, to go with 8.5 TFL, three sacks and four quarterback hurries
• Had a season-high seven tackles along with four TFL and one sack in win over Stephen F. Austin
• Also had one sack at SMU and against USF
• Had a two-yard receiving touchdown along with a season-best two quarterback hurries in the Montgomery Bowl against Florida Atlantic
2019 (Redshirt Junior)
• Named an all-conference honorable mention honoree at defensive line after helping Memphis to its first outright American Athletic Conference Championship and a Goodyear Cotton Bowl appearance
• Finished with 45 total tackles, including 28 solos
• He added five sacks, 14.5 TFL, one fumble recovery and five quarterback hurries
• His five sacks and 14.5 TFL ranked second on the team behind Bryce Huff
• Opened the season with a sack and quarterback hurry in a win over Ole Miss
• Added 1.5 sacks in a road win at ULM, adding 4.0 TFL for 19 yards in that game
• In the regular season finale against Cincinnati, in a game Memphis needed to win to get into the AAC Championship game, he had 4.0 TFL and two sacks to help Memphis earn the right to host the championship game and win its first outright championship
2018 (Redshirt Sophomore)
• Played in all 14 games, including the Birmingham Bowl
• Ninth on team with 50 total hits (30 solo)
• His 50 total tackles and 30 solo hits led all defensive linemen
• Had 10 multi-tackle performances • Credited with seven TFL (36 yards), six sacks (35 yards), seven QB hurries, two PBU and one forced fumble
• Seven QB hurries were tied for team lead
• Continued role in the offensive backfield as part of a jumbo package
• Had one catch for one yard
• Logged a career-high six total tackles three times vs Navy (3 solo), Tulane (3 solo) and Wake Forest (5 solo) in the Birmingham Bowl
• His five solo hits vs the Demon Deacons were a career-best
• Tied a career-high with two TFL vs UCF
• Both TFL vs the Knights were sacks, and the two sacks were a career-best
• The 13 TFL/sack yardage vs UCF was a career-high • Had best all-around performance vs UCF with five total tackles (4 solo), two TFL, two sacks, one forced fumble and one PBU
• His forced fumble was recovered by John Tate IV and ended a Knights’ threat in Memphis territory (UCF had recovered a Memphis fumble three plays earlier at the Tigers 33-yard line)
• Recorded a career-high four QB hurries in a win at ECU
• Hauled in his first collegiate reception (1 yard) late in the fourth quarter vs ECU
• Caught the pass on a third-and-goal at the ECU 2
• His catch set up a Tony Pollard 1-yard TD run
• In a key win at SMU, had five total tackles (1 solo), 1.5 TFL, one sack and one PBU
• Registered four tackles (3 solo) vs UCF in the American Championship Game
2017 (Redshirt Freshman)
• Saw action in 11 games, including the AutoZone Liberty Bowl
• Logged 16 total stops (11 solo), 5.0 TFL (12 yards) and one sack (6 yards)
• Had four multi-tackle performances
• Registered one PBU and one QB hurry
• Also saw game action on offense in jumbo packages
• Posted a season-best five total tackles (3 solo) in the Tigers’ come-from-behind win at Houston
• Credited with first collegiate tackle in a road win at Connecticut
• Finished the game vs the Huskies with three solo stops and his first collegiate TFL/sack (6 yards)
• Had four total tackles (2 solo) in a road win at Tulsa
• Logged three total hits (2 solo), two TFL (4 yards), one PBU and one QB hurry in a home win over ECU
• Made his collegiate debut in a home victory over Southern Illinois
2016 (Freshman)
• Redshirted
Prior to Memphis/Personal
• Played defensive end and running back at Spring High School in Spring, Texas, for head coach Sam Parker
• Helped the Lions to an 11-2 overall record his senior season
• On offense, had 41 carries for 238 yards and 15 TD
• Had a season-long rush of 37 yards
• Son of Dorete Dorceus
• Older brother, Doroland, was a member of the Tigers program from 2013-17
